The Mythbusters team successfully managed to fold a sheet of paper eight times without any machinery. However, they faced considerable challenges after the seventh fold. Imagine the difficulty of moving 128 layers of a giant football-field-sized sheet of paper! To achieve 11 folds, they had to resort to a steamroller and a forklift.

Origami mobiles and lighting by Etsy shop FiberStore. Origami bonsai by Benjamin John Coleman. Origami jewelry and home decor by Raya Sader …Oct 7, 2019 · Mountain Fold. Dana Hinders. The mountain fold is essentially a valley fold in reverse. A mountain fold gets its name because it makes the paper rise up like a mountain. In traditional origami diagrams, a mountain fold is indicated by a line made of dashes and dots. Sometimes, there will also be an arrow that indicates the folding direction. Frog Origami for Kids. Choose any color you'd like, so long as the two sides are different in color or texture.The original Moravian stars had 110 spikes but later a simpler, 26 spike star prevailed. The Moravian stars made by strip folding are still 3-dimensional, but are reduced to have 16 spikes. Four strips of paper are needed to make one star.
